No. 1.1.06

Surplus Property Distribution and Disposal

1.0  Purpose:
To set forth procedures and instructions for distribution and disposal of surplus property.

2.0  Policy:
The Materials Management is responsible for distribution and disposal of all surplus property.  Surplus property may be transferred to another Budget Unit through the Materials Management and may be utilized for institutional purposes only.  Surplus property cannot be sold or donated to any individual employed by the Institution.

NOTE: For purposes of the Section, property is defined as supplies, equipment, or other items purchased for institutional use.

3.0 Procedure: Request to Surplus Property

Responsibility: Department Assistant Property Control Officer

3.1 Complete ARequest for Moving Services@ form.  Property record numbers for each piece of surplus equipment must be indicated.  Forms are available from Asset Management at 1-2154 or at  www.mcg.edu/supply/property/MOVREQ.pdf

3.2 Forward completed forms to Moving and Surplus Property Services (fax 1-2189) at least 48 hours prior to the intended removal of the surplus property.

NOTE:   Surplus equipment such as lab refrigerators, freezers, centrifuges, biosafety cabinets, or any other equipment that may be contaminated by radiation, biological, or chemical substances must be decontaminated.  Please attach a completed Decontamination Form www.mcg.edu/supply/property/deconform.pdf to the Moving Request and equipment to be picked up.

3.3 Insure confidential information is deleted from hard drives of surplus computer equipment.

3.4 Notify ADepartment Contact Person@ designated on request of the following responsibilities.

a. To be knowledgeable of all items, and their condition (working, need repair, etc.), to be removed.

b. To supervise packing of all loose items prior to removal.

c. To be available the day scheduled for removal to ensure that proper items are removed.

3.5 Determine if assistance is needed to disconnect items that involve plumbing, electrical, mechanical, or carpentry work; contact the Facilities Management Division in sufficient time to have the work accomplished prior to removal.

Responsibility: Facilities Management Division

3.6 Complete the work needed to disconnect items as requested.

Responsibility: Materials Management, Moving and Surplus Property Services

3.7 Receive ARequest for Moving Services,@ schedule removal of surplus property, and complete the work as scheduled.

3.8 Maintain a list of surplus property available for transfer at the Asset Management website. Coordinate and accomplish transfers as requested.

3.9 Forward ARequest for Moving Services,@ indicating transferred and surplus property, to the Materials Management, Asset Management Section.

Responsibility: Materials Management, Asset Management Section

3.10 Update AMoveable Equipment Inventory@ to reflect changes resulting from on-campus transfer of surplus property.

3.11 Determine federally funded items not transferred to another Budget Unit.

3.12 Notify DOAS of appropriate disposition of federally funded items after consulting the Division of Sponsored Program Administration.

Responsibility: Materials Management, Moving and Surplus Property Services

3.13 Dispose of surplus property in accordance with State Law and Federal Agency decisions.
